Sacred Seeds: Children of Abraham Reading Text Together

Since 2008, ECRA has sponsored ongoing interreligious gatherings called "Sacred Seeds" in Edgewater. At each event, local leaders of the Jewish, Christian and Muslim communities discuss a chosen shared sacred texts and their tradition's understandings of the images, metaphors and purpose of these stories. So far, several hundred people from the neighborhood have been richly blessed by these encounters. Download some videos here.

Annual Interfaith Thanksgiving Service

ECRA Thanksgiving Service
Sunday, November 22, 2009
Time:
4:00pm - 7:00pm

Location:
Episcopal Church of the Atonement

On Sunday, November 22nd, at 4pm, the Edgewater Community Religious Association joined together in our annual interfaith Thanksgiving Prayer Service. This great annual event provides an opportunity to learn more about religious traditions represented in Edgewater (Jewish, Muslim, sometimes Buddhist, Catholic, Protestant, and more) and to gather with our neighbors of faith. The service features music and readings and stories from different religious traditions.
